[0075] The present invention will be further described below in conjunction with the accompanying drawings and embodiments.

[0076] A kind of active distribution network coordination planning method considering multi-subject interest game of the present invention comprises the following steps,

[0077] Step S1. Considering that the three parties of "network-source-load" each aim to maximize the annual net income, determine their respective objective functions and constraints, and establish independent planning models for the network layer, source layer, and load layer.

[0078] Step S2. Taking the three parties of "network-source-load" to achieve the balance and stability of their respective interests in the game as the upper-level goal, establish an upper-level strategic game planning model, and design different initial game sequences in the model;

Abstract

The invention relates to an active power distribution network coordination planning method considering a multi-subject benefit game. The method comprises the following steps of: firstly, determining respective objective functions and constraint conditions by taking the maximum annual net income as an objective of a network-source-load main body, and respectively establishing independent planning models of a network layer, a source layer and a load layer; then, an upper-layer strategy type game planning model is established with the fact that the three-party subjects achieve respective benefitbalance and stability in the game as an upper-layer target; taking the minimum reduction amount of the distributed power supply corresponding to wind curtailment and light curtailment as a target, andestablishing a lower-layer active management model by considering on-load transformer tap adjustment and energy storage adjustment; information transmission of the upper-layer game planning model andthe lower-layer active management model is considered, and a complete active power distribution network coordination planning model considering the multi-subject benefit game is established. The model established by the invention better adapts to maximization of benefit pursuits of all subjects in the gradually open power market, and the planning scheme solved based on the model can realize 'network-source-load' multi-subject friendly interaction and coordinate the overall planning.
